Master’s Student Diversity

Among recent graduates, 30% of special education master’s degrees went to men and 70% went to women.

DeSales University gender breakdown of Special Education Master's degree grads The largest share of special education master’s degree graduates at DeSales University are White. About 90% of graduates fell into this category.
